Automatic Data Processing Inc

TECHNOLOGY · SOFTWARE - APPLICATION · USA

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(ADP) is an American provider of human resources management software and services.

Cadence Design Systems Inc

TECHNOLOGY · SOFTWARE - APPLICATION · USA

Cadence Design Systems, Inc., headquartered in San Jose, California, is an American multinational computational software company. The company produces software, hardware and silicon structures for designing integrated circuits, systems on chips (SoCs) and printed circuit boards.
